Introduction to Bongs

Bongs, also known as water pipes, are a popular method of smoking that dates back centuries. They offer a unique experience that is both enjoyable and visually captivating. This article explores the world of bongs, from their history and craftsmanship to their usage and cultural impact.

Historical Perspective

The use of water pipes for smoking can be traced back to ancient civilizations, with evidence of their existence in Africa, India, and the Middle East. Over time, these devices have evolved and spread across the globe, taking on various forms and styles.

The Science Behind Bongs

Bongs work on the principle of filtration through water. The smoke is drawn through a tube, passing through water which cools and filters the smoke, reducing the harshness and tar content. This results in a smoother and often more flavorful smoking experience.

Crafting the Perfect Bong

Bongs can be made from a variety of materials, including glass, ceramic, and acrylic. The most revered bongs are hand-blown glass, which requires a high level of skill and craftsmanship. The process involves heating the glass to a molten state and shaping it using a combination of tools and breath control.

Types of Bongs

There is a wide variety of bongs available, catering to different preferences and needs. Some common types include:

Straight Tubes: Simple and classic, these bongs have a straight tube for the smoke to travel through.

Beaker Bases: Featuring a wider base for stability, these bongs often have additional percolators for better filtration.

Recycler Bongs: These bongs recycle the smoke through the water, providing an extra layer of filtration and cooling.

The Smoking Experience

One of the main attractions of bongs is the enhanced smoking experience they provide. The water filtration system not only cools the smoke but also helps to capture some of the larger particles, leading to a smoother inhale.

Health Considerations

While bongs can reduce some of the harshness of smoking, it's important to note that they do not eliminate all health risks associated with smoking. The water in a bong can filter out some of the larger particulates, but many harmful substances can still pass through.

Maintenance and Care

Proper maintenance is essential to ensure the longevity and optimal performance of a bong. Regular cleaning and proper storage are key. Using cleaning solutions designed for bongs can help remove residue and maintain the purity of the smoking experience.
